About Us
GE Healthcare provides transformational medical technologies that are helping a new age of patient care. GE Healthcare's expertise in medical imagine and information technologies, medical diagnostics, patient monitoring and life support systems, disease research, drug discovery, and biopharmaceutical manufacturing technologies is helping physicians detect disease earlier and to tailor personalized treatments for patients. GE Healthcare offers a broad range of products and services that are improving productivity in health and enhancing patient care by enabling healthcare providers to better diagnose and treat cancer, heart disease, neurological diseases, and other conditions. Headquartered in the United Kingdom, GE Healthcare is a $15 billion unit of General Electric Company (NYSE: GE). Worldwide, GE Healthcare employs more than 43,000 people committed to serving healthcare professionals and their patients in more than 100 countries.
Role Summary/Purpose
The Systems Engineer has design responsibility to deliver customer workflow, feature functionality, product quality, reliability, serviceability, manufacturability, regulatory, compliance, and cost. Activities include requirements development, traceability and flow down, architecture / system design and analysis, FMEA, developing/executing System Verification and Validation test procedures, and providing support to manufacturing and field issues.
Essential Responsibilities
Duties include (but are not limited to): - Providing domain expertise to serve as the main integrator between the hardware and software functions to deliver the best high quality product - Working across functions and team boundaries to define, design, and implement the next generation of products - Working with customers, Marketing and field personnel to refine requirements which can be refined by the engineering teams - Developing methods to quantify subsystem interactions and their effects on image quality - Delivering and incorporating feedback results into new hardware, software and service specifications
